Transaction ed81297630dc596bdf3bc63369452c85d152e0c30908c8cede3ddf2fd4b70b5a
1 Input
1 Output
-
ed81297630dc596bdf3bc63369452c85d152e0c30908c8cede3ddf2fd4b70b5a:0
- value
- 277599322
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e4cb40804385f2075b5d33592e9dcc8183f098d OP_EQUALVERIFY OP_CHECKSIG
- address
- 12JcM7zyKr9DJ1fNv7VPq9zdExUb8BtyvR